Hey team — handing off the Lintwell baseline file for the Corvid project before I roll off. The baseline (lint-baseline.yml) freezes about 340 legacy warnings so new code stays clean; don't regenerate it without pinging Marit first, or the diff gets ugly. Support folks: if a build fails on baseline drift, re-run the check with --frozen and attach the log. The baseline lives in the Ossuary vault, which is passphrase-protected. You'll need the recovery passphrase below to unlock it.

unlock words, hahip-yagef: zorok-novmir-zorix-silax

## Releases

Heads up: firmware builds for the Lumenpost LP-4 ship through the `stable-ota` channel only. The CI job bundles the image, runs the delta check, and pushes to the Fernwick update broker — don't hand-roll artifacts, reviewers have caught that twice now. Bump `fw_version` in the manifest or devices will silently skip the update. All images must be signed before the broker accepts them, using the key below.

release key, hadug-kawef: bky13_mPGeFZeR1GZ1G

## Idempotency Keys for Payment Retries (Lumopay)

Every retry of a charge request must reuse the original idempotency key; generating a new key on retry can produce duplicate charges. Keys are scoped per merchant and expire after 48 hours. Reviewers should verify keys are derived server-side, never from client input. The full key-generation specification and threat model are maintained on the internal page.

dashboard of kaguf-tawip = https://vault.merlaqsys.test/issue

**Q: How do I restore the PickPath optimizer config if the Vexhall warehouse node wipes its local cache?**

A: The optimizer at Vexhall rebuilds its route weights from the central Lorridge cluster, but the encrypted config bundle requires a manual unlock first. As a contractor, you won't have standing credentials, so use the shared recovery flow documented in the Orbin runbook. Run the restore script, wait for the integrity check to pass, and when prompted, enter the recovery passphrase shown below.

unlock words, tawif-tahop: oliys-ulawyn-tamdor-lamys-casox-jormir-fraius-kasath-ulador-ulamir-holir-sorys-holeth